Properties of PVC Cabinets

PVC cabinets offer a range of durable and versatile properties for your storage needs. When it comes to durability, PVC cabinets are a top choice. They are resistant to moisture, which makes them perfect for areas with high humidity, such as kitchens and bathrooms. Unlike wooden cabinets, PVC cabinets do not warp or rot over time, ensuring that they will last for years to come.

In addition to their durability, PVC cabinets also offer a wide range of design options. Whether you prefer a sleek and modern look or a more traditional style, PVC cabinets can be customized to suit your taste. They come in various colors and finishes, allowing you to create a cohesive and visually appealing storage solution for your space.

Furthermore, PVC cabinets are easy to clean and maintain. Unlike cabinets made from other materials, PVC cabinets can simply be wiped down with a damp cloth to remove any dirt or stains. This makes them an ideal choice for busy households or commercial spaces where cleanliness is a priority.

Advantages of PVC Cabinets

When choosing storage solutions, you’ll appreciate the many advantages of opting for PVC cabinets. One of the most significant advantages is the durability and longevity of PVC cabinets. PVC, or polyvinyl chloride, is a strong and resilient material that can withstand the test of time. Unlike other cabinet materials, PVC cabinets are resistant to moisture, impact, and chemicals. This makes them ideal for both indoor and outdoor use, as they can withstand harsh weather conditions without deteriorating. With PVC cabinets, you won’t have to worry about warping, cracking, or peeling, ensuring that your storage solution remains in excellent condition for years to come.

Another advantage of PVC cabinets is the wide range of customization options available. PVC is a versatile material that can be easily molded and shaped to fit any design or style preference. Whether you prefer a sleek and modern look or a more traditional and rustic aesthetic, PVC cabinets can be customized to suit your needs. Additionally, PVC cabinets come in a variety of colors, finishes, and patterns, allowing you to personalize your storage solution to match your existing decor. With PVC cabinets, you have the freedom to create a unique and functional storage solution that complements your space perfectly.

Installation Process of PVC Cabinets

To install PVC cabinets, gather the necessary tools and materials for the installation process. You will need a measuring tape, a level, a drill, screws, brackets, and a screwdriver. Before starting the installation, it’s important to have a clear plan in mind. Measure the space where the cabinets will be installed and mark the positions on the wall. Use a level to ensure that the lines are straight.

Next, it’s time to mount the brackets on the wall. Use a drill to make pilot holes for the screws, then attach the brackets securely. Once the brackets are in place, you can start installing the cabinets. Lift the cabinets onto the brackets and secure them with screws. Make sure they are level and aligned properly.

When it comes to installation techniques, there are a few things to consider. One popular method is the “hang and click” technique, where the cabinets are hung on the brackets and then clicked into place. This method is quick and efficient, perfect for DIY enthusiasts. Another technique is using a rail system, where a rail is installed on the wall and the cabinets are hung on it. This method offers more flexibility in terms of adjusting the position of the cabinets.

Maintenance Tips for PVC Cabinets

To maintain your PVC cabinets, follow these simple tips. Cleaning your PVC cabinets regularly is essential to keep them looking their best. Start by wiping down the cabinets with a soft cloth or sponge dampened with mild dish soap and warm water.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or scrub brushes, as they can damage the surface of the PVC. After cleaning, make sure to dry the cabinets thoroughly to prevent water spots or streaks.

To prevent scratches on your PVC cabinets, it’s important to handle them with care. Avoid using sharp objects or abrasive materials when cleaning or working near the cabinets. Instead, use non-abrasive cleaning tools and gentle motions to remove any dirt or grime. If you do notice any scratches on the surface, you can try using a mild abrasive cleaner specifically designed for PVC to buff them out.

Another tip to keep your PVC cabinets looking their best is to avoid placing hot items directly on the surface. Use trivets or heat-resistant mats to protect the PVC from heat damage. Additionally, be mindful of any chemicals or solvents that may come into contact with the cabinets, as they can cause discoloration or damage.

Choosing the Right PVC Cabinets for Your Home

When selecting PVC cabinets for your home, consider your specific needs and preferences. PVC cabinets are a popular choice for many homeowners due to their durability and versatility. Here are four key factors to consider when choosing the right PVC cabinets for your home:

  1. Choosing durable PVC cabinets: Look for cabinets that are made from high-quality PVC material that can withstand everyday wear and tear. Opt for cabinets with reinforced corners and sturdy construction to ensure longevity.
  2. Customizing PVC cabinets for your space: PVC cabinets come in a variety of sizes and styles, allowing you to customize them to fit your specific space. Consider the dimensions of your room and the storage needs you have in mind. Look for cabinets that offer adjustable shelving or additional accessories for better organization.
  3. Design and aesthetics: PVC cabinets come in a wide range of finishes and colors, allowing you to find the perfect match for your home decor. Consider the overall style and ambiance of your space and choose cabinets that complement it seamlessly.
  4. Budget considerations: PVC cabinets are a cost-effective option compared to other materials like wood. Set a budget and explore different options within that range to find cabinets that meet your requirements without breaking the bank.
